原文:神经网络中的激活函数具体是什么?为什么Relu要好过与tanh和sigmoid function

为什么要引入激活函数 如果不用激活函数 其实相当于激励函数是f x x ,在这种情况下你每一层输出都是上层输入的线性函数,很容易验证,无论你神经网络有多少层,输出都是输入的线性组合,与没有隐藏层效果相当,这种情况就是最原始的感知机了。 正因为上面的原因,我们决定引入非线性函数作为激励函数,这样深层神经网络就有意义了 不再是是输入的线性组合,可以逼近任意函数 。最早的想法是sigmoid函数或者ta ...

2018-10-13 14:53 0 1840 推荐指数:

查看详情

神经网络激活函数具体是什么?为什么ReLu要好过tanhsigmoid function?(转)

为什么引入激活函数? 如果不用激励函数(其实相当于激励函数是f(x) = x),在这种情况下你每一层输出都是上层输入的线性函数,很容易验证,无论你神经网络有多少层,输出都是输入的线性组合,与没有隐藏层效果相当,这种情况就是最原始的感知机(Perceptron)了。 正因为上面的原因,我们决定 ...

Fri Aug 31 03:46:00 CST 2018 0 1144
神经网络激活函数tanh sigmoid RELU softplus softmatx

所谓激活函数,就是在神经网络神经元上运行的函数,负责将神经元的输入映射到输出端。常见的激活函数包括Sigmoid、TanHyperbolic(tanh)、ReLu、 softplus以及softmax函数。这些函数有一个共同的特点那就是他们都是非线性的函数。那么我们为什么要在神经网络引入非线性 ...

Thu May 11 19:04:00 CST 2017 0 6070
神经网络激活函数softmax,sigmoidtanhrelu总结

神经网络激活函数softmax,sigmoidtanhrelu总结 一、总结 一句话总结: 常见激活函数:softmax、sigmoidtanhrelu 二、【神经网络激活函数softmax,sigmoidtanhrelu总结 转自或参考:【神经网络激活函数 ...

Tue Aug 04 13:35:00 CST 2020 0 1074
激活函数sigmoidtanhrelu、Swish

激活函数的作用主要是引入非线性因素,解决线性模型表达能力不足的缺陷   sigmoid函数可以从图像中看出,当x向两端走的时候,y值越来越接近1和-1,这种现象称为饱和,饱和意味着当x=100和x=1000的映射结果是一样的,这种转化相当于将1000大于100的信息丢失了很多,所以一般需要归一化 ...

Thu Sep 27 06:24:00 CST 2018 0 3885
深度学习激活函数sigmoidtanhReLU

三种非线性激活函数sigmoidtanhReLUsigmoid: y = 1/(1 + e-x) tanh: y = (ex - e-x)/(ex + e-x) ReLU:y = max(0, x) 在隐藏层,tanh函数要优于sigmoid函数,可以看作 ...

Tue Apr 14 04:01:00 CST 2020 0 2503
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M